## Local Setup — Telemetry Compression Pipeline

Before cutting a release of Murkwell Collector, verify the compression path end to end. Install the toolchain with `make deps`, then run `make bench-compress` to confirm zstd dictionary payloads stay under the 64 KB envelope limit. The pipeline records per-batch compression ratios and decode timings in a local metrics database, and the release checklist requires a clean run against it. Configure the metrics store by placing the connection string below in your environment file.

replica DSN, kajep-yahag: mssql://praok_svc:iF@db-8d68.plorvaio.local:5432/eliion

## Releases

Hey support folks — quick notes on ProfileMesh shard releases. Each release re-balances user-profile shards gradually, so don't panic if a lookup lands on a stale shard for a few minutes post-deploy; it self-heals. Release bundles are published twice a month and are always signed. If a customer asks you to verify a bundle they downloaded, walk them through the checksum step using the public signing key below.

deploy key for kawif-bageg: bky19_YQNdHDgpaLxUNwPoHm9

Key ceremony checklist — Step 7: Before signing, confirm the customer deduplication job on Merrivale's Ledgerbird platform has completed its final pass. Duplicate records must be merged so the master list matches the counts witnessed earlier. The new contractor should verify the merge log with the ceremony officer, then initial the worksheet. Once both parties agree the dedupe totals reconcile, unseal the envelope and read out the recovery passphrase printed below.

unlock words, tawif-tahop: oliys-ulawyn-tamdor-lamys-casox-jormir-fraius-kasath-ulador-ulamir-holir-sorys-holeth

## Account Recovery — Dripwise Scheduler

When a customer loses access to their Dripwise plant-watering account, verify identity per standard support policy, then open the admin recovery tool and select the affected account. The tool will prompt for the team recovery credential before issuing a reset link. Enter the passphrase shown directly below.

vault phrase of tajeg-tageg = pelix-druix-holius-briael-zorwyn-frawyn-fraox-norok-drueth-aldiel